AIRCRAFT COMPONENTS Sample Clauses

The 'AIRCRAFT COMPONENTS' clause defines the terms and conditions governing the use, maintenance, replacement, or supply of parts and components for an aircraft. It typically outlines the responsibilities of each party regarding the sourcing of genuine or approved parts, the standards for installation and maintenance, and procedures for handling defective or unserviceable components. This clause ensures that all aircraft components meet safety and regulatory requirements, thereby minimizing operational risks and clarifying obligations related to aircraft upkeep.
AIRCRAFT COMPONENTS. Unless otherwise noted on the Buyer’s order, Buyer warrants that the goods or services subject to this Offer are not intended for use as components or components of assemblies used in aircraft (military or commercial).
AIRCRAFT COMPONENTS. For parts or components for aviation equipment the retention periods are at least 25 years with a subsequent requirement of release to Customer for destruction of the documents. The records are to be made available on request of the Customer and may only be destroyed after consultation and release by Customer.
